Mr. Bud Light and Known Associates Investigated

Mr. Bud Light and associates in FUSA Litter Police Line-up

Sedona AZ (December 3, 2012) – The Folksville USA (FVUSA) Litter Police and Folksville CSI Departments are on the lookout for the culprits who had a “hand” in the crime of tossing a Mr. Bud Light and his associates onto a local highway. After a review of the complaint, the FVUSA Litter Police determined Mr. Bud Light and his associates were not guilty of throwing themselves on the Arizona highway and they had been victimized by others who left the crime scene.

The Folksville USA Litter Police issued an all-points bulletin to be on the lookout for callous offenders committing litter crimes against Arizona highways.

During the recent investigation, Mr. Light’s family and associates were put in a Folksville USA Litter Police line-up for identification. While being questioned, Mr. Bud Light told investigators that his family and associates “have been and continue to be the most commonly tossed about family in Arizona’s Yavapai County.” Mr. Light expressed upset that “so many folks abuse his family and associates causing them to be continually under suspicion by the FVUSA Litter Police.”

A FVUSA Litter Police deputy reminded Mr. Light to be careful with whom he associates. Mr. Light responded by saying, “This has been bottled up in me for some time now. Me and my associates are taken and tossed against our will by people with no respect for themselves or the community. Litterers don’t care about the cost to taxpayers or America the Beautiful! What can we do?”

Mr. Light (photo above center) told this reporter, “…the people out there need to provide the FVUSA CSI department with information that helps apprehend for education and or fines those responsible for tossing me and my associates about!”

Mr. Bud Light, his family, and associates were taken to a recycling facility for their own protection by the Folksville USA Litter Police.

With the holidays around the corner, and a noticeable increase in alcoholic containers thrown by the wayside, the FVUSA Litter Police are on the lookout for those tossing Mr. Bud Light and or Bud’s family and associates along the highway. Be aware, others can care!
